Edward Witten, an influential physicist who developed M-theory, recently started thinking about how to scan the solar system for a primordial black hole. To find these ripples, Taylor and his colleagues measure the regular flashes of light from pulsars, which are neutron stars that spin extremely fast and blast out beams of light, much like a cosmic lighthouse. Our Solar system has a very sparse Oort Cloud, extending perhaps almost 2 light-years and a much more densely packed, but still quite diffuse, Kuiper-belt, mostly about 30-50 AU (less than a thousandth of a light year).
